More than 4,800 voters turned out for early voting for the primary election from Aug. 4 to Saturday, according to the Osceola County Supervisor of Elections Office.

The St. Cloud Library saw the largest turnout with 1,285 voters; the Supervisor of Elections Office had the next largest turnout with 1,002 voters over the six day period.

Hart Memorial Central Library in Kissimmee logged 853 voters, the Poinciana Branch tallied 807 voters and the Buenaventura Lakes Branch had 653 voters.

The West Osceola Branch Library in Celebration logged 278 voters.

The primary election is Tuesday. Polling locations will be open from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m.

The general election will be held Nov. 6.
